Shaquille O’Neal or DJ Diesel will play at the Indy 500
Shaquille O’Neal is set to reprise his role as DJ Diesel for the Indianapolis 500. He will play at the Snake Pit alongside legendary names like John Summit, Kaskade, and Jauz.
DJ Diesel will be spinning the decks throughout the morning of May 28th and tickets are on sale, starting at $50. So if you wanna see your favorite NBA legend moonlight as a DJ, now is your chance.

Shaq also DJs at his 1 Million NFL Watch Party
Shaq also DJs around the world in festivals like Tomorrowland and Ultra Miami. But he also has a super high-end VIP Super Bowl viewing party. The cost of which is an eye-popping $1 million.
Yes, and not only that you will get to meet all of Shaquille O’Neal’s rich and famous friends.
It is less about the NFL and more about splurging. Of course, you will also see DJ Diesel spin tunes. So win win.
